Fuel consumption

Fuel consumption (l/100km): 6.45.8
Real fuel consumption: 6.9 l/100km6.6 l/100km
The Honda Accord is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y.
By specification Mazda 6 consumes 0.6 litres more fuel per 100 km than the Honda Accord, which means that if you drive 15,000 km in a year, the Mazda 6 could require 90 litres more fuel.
By comparing actual fuel consumption based on user reports, Mazda 6 consumes 0.3 litres more fuel per 100 km than the Honda Accord.

Engines

Average engine lifespan: 370'000 km350'000 km
Engine resource depends largely on regular maintenance and the quality of the oils and fuels used.
Engine production duration: 3 years8 years
Engine spread: Used also on Mazda MPVInstalled on at least 3 other car models, including Honda CR-V, Honda Civic, Honda FR-V
In general, the longer and for more car models an engine is produced, the better its serviceability and availability of spare parts. Honda Accord might be a better choice in this respect.
